Suspects arrested in fatal road rage shooting of 6-year-old boy

Two suspects were arrested Sunday in connection to the road rage shooting that killed a 6-year-old boy on a California highway, a report said.

Eriz Marcus Anthony, 24, and Lee Wynn, 23, were busted at their Costa Mesa home and are expected to be charged with murder in the May 21 death of Aiden Leos, CBS LA reported, citing the California Highway Patrol.

Aiden was being driven to school by his mother, Joanna Cloonan, on 55 Freeway when they were cut off by a white sedan.

Cloonan has said as she “merged” away from the vehicle, she heard a loud noise before discovering her son had been shot.

“I pulled over and I took him out of the car and I tried to put my hand on his wounds while calling 911. Because he was losing a lot of blood,” the mother told “Good Morning America.”

The boy was rushed to the hospital, where he was pronounced dead.
